Obama's new nuanced counter-terrorism policy (B Raman, 8/07/09, Rediff)
The new policy as outlined by [John O Brennan, a former career intelligence officer of the Central Intelligence Agency, who now functions as President Barack Obama'sAssistant for Homeland Security and Counterterrorism] will be a mix of hard and soft power, the professional and political options and treating terrorism as a threat and at the same time as a phenomenon, which requires a multi-dimensional approach. He was critical of attempts to make the entire foreign policy hostage to counter-terrorism. It will no more be a war on terror as projected by the previous administration of George W Bush. Instead, it will be a campaign against terrorism.
